Despite the early achievements of Dimitri Hegemann’s UFO Club, by mid-1988, its numbers have been dwindling. Once the wall came down, on the other hand, it had been all of a sudden packed, being a era hungry for enjoyable and adventure headed out to take a look at Berlin’s nightlife. Seeing option, in 1991 Hegemann opened a different club inside the vaults of a previous department shop. Called Tresor, early guests bundled lots of Detroit’s pioneers, who played their 1st Berlin displays within the club.

Typically known as “Acid”, Acid Techno is often a derivative of Acid Residence which produced in Europe in the late 80s and early 90s. The Roland TB-303 bass synthesizer provides it its exceptional seem where resonance and cutoff frequencies in many cases are manipulated in real-time when recording a track.
